More than 190,000 people reside in some 4,100 special care institutions in Canada. The majority of emergency plans developed by such facilities cover only fire emergencies, and only the evacuation response. This manual sets out guidelines and suggestions for wider emergency plans, both in emergencies covered, and in possible reponses. It is intended for those administrators of institutions who have no emergency plan, and who want to prepare one, or who wish to review exisiting plans
